Energy Auditing
By Dao Vang The California Higher Education Sustainability Conference was astonishing. Aside from the huge networking opportunities, the conference was filled with remarkable workshops. One of these workshops was the Energy Audit training instructed by Jeffrey Steuben. This workshop allowed the participants to gain a hand on experience of how to perform an energy audit. During the Energy Audit training, energy auditing tools were accessible for participants to become familiar with the equipment Tools such as light meters, electrical circuit tracer, and digital thermometers were demonstrated and afterward, available for participants to gain experience of the devices. The workshop also contained a written exercise, which provided knowledge on metric conversions. This exercise was on basic energy auditing such as how to many therms is in a BTU or kilowatt to watts. It also explained how to calculate savings and payback period. This was a very beneficial workshop. It consisted of knowledge every energy auditor will need to know. It also provided a rich experience as one becomes familiar with the equipment necessary for an energy audit. This was one of many amazing workshops available at the conference.
